Phoebe

16Verse 1I commend to you our sister Phoebe, who is a servant of the congregation in Cenchrea,Verse 2so that you may receive her in the Lord in a manner worthy of the saints, and assist her in whatever matter she may need from you; for indeed she herself has been a helper of many, including my own self.

Greetings

Verse 3Greet Prisca and Aquila, my fellow workers in Christ Jesus,Verse 4who risked their own necks for my life;+to whom not only I give thanks, but also all the congregations of the Gentiles.Verse 5And greet the congregation that is in their house.+Greet my beloved Epaenetus, who is the first convert to Christ from Achaia.+Verse 6Greet Mary, who worked very hard for you.+Verse 7Greet Andronicus and Junias, my countrymen and my fellow prisoners, who are outstanding among the apostles, and who were in Christ before me.Verse 8Greet Amplias, my beloved in the Lord.Verse 9Greet Urbanus, our fellow worker in Christ, and my beloved Stachys.Verse 10Greet Apelles, approved in Christ. Greet those who are of the household of Aristobulus.Verse 11Greet Herodian, my countryman. Greet those who are of the household of Narcissus, who are in the Lord.Verse 12Greet Tryphena and Tryphosa, who have worked hard in the Lord. Greet the beloved Persis, who has worked very hard in the Lord.+Verse 13Greet Rufus, chosen in the Lord, also his mother, and mine.+Verse 14Greet Asyncritus, Phlegon, Hermas, Patrobas, Hermes, and the brothers who are with them.Verse 15Greet Philologus and Julia, Nereus and his sister, also Olympus and all the saints who are with them.+Verse 16Greet one another with a holy kiss. The congregations of Christ greet you.

Warning

Verse 17Now I exhort you, brothers, to watch out for those who cause divisions and offenses, contrary to the doctrine you have learned, and avoid them.Verse 18Because such people do not serve our Lord Jesus+Christ, but their own belly, and by smooth talk and flattery they deceive the hearts of the unsuspecting.+Verse 19I rejoice over you because your obedience has become known to all, but I want you to be wise as to what is good, yet innocent as to what is evil.+Verse 20The God of peace will quickly crush Satan under your feet!+Sign-off The grace of our Lord Jesus Christ+be with you.Verse 21Timothy, my fellow worker, greets you, as do Lucius, Jason and Sosipater, my countrymen.Verse 22I, Tertius, who penned this letter in the Lord, greet you.Verse 23Gaius, host to me and the whole congregation, greets you. Erastus, the city treasurer, greets you, as does brother Quartus.+Verse 24The grace of our Lord Jesus Christ be with us+all! Amen.+
